Common Technology Projects in Banking Environments

Technology teams support a wide range of initiatives that require coordination and planning across departments.

Examples include:

  • Digital banking platform implementation
  • Core system modernization
  • Mobile application development
  • Cybersecurity initiatives
  • Data management projects
  • Cloud migration programs
  • Infrastructure upgrades
  • Process automation initiatives
  • Payment system enhancements
  • Customer experience technology improvements

Managing these projects effectively often requires a combination of technical expertise and project leadership skills.
